When we don’t have what we want and can’t see how we might get there, we often feel powerless to change. It can feel like life is against you in this one critical area of your life - your love life. It’s funny too that other areas of life can be really good.

Do you catch yourself looking at others in relationship and fixating on “What’s wrong me?” If you know this thought, you probably know those other downward spiraling depressing thoughts like:

Why not me?
It will never be my turn
I’m a hopeless cause.
At the bottom of that downward spiral, I’ve experienced despair, depression, and a sense of defeat that seemed endless. All I wanted to do was curl up in a ball and escape my life in TV.

Our instant TV society betrays us here. In a half hour sitcom, there isn’t much room for the journey. There is no time for hope. It seems that we are lonely and desperate or we are phenomenally ecstatic in relationship. Life is portrayed as instantaneous. My life is not a sitcom or a drama or a tragedy. It’s just my life.
